Recent studies have shown that the combination of advanced technology and social vague rules of such organizations, forming a complex system that encounter with a new type of risk. The type of risk that inaccessible to conventional risk analysis approaches.Therefore, in this paper, with comprehensive review of recent studies, the ineffectiveness of traditional risk analysis methods in complex socio-technical systems will prove and the roots of this inefficiency will analyze. Results and conclusion: The ineffectiveness of traditional risk analysis methods in complex socio-technical systems, rooted in the inefficiencies of out of date accident models and theories that have shaped the theoretical field of these method.
